Book Launch Event: Towards a New Scientific Realism, von Jan Voosholz

The International Center for Philosophy and the Center for Science and Thought cordially invite you to the book launch event of Jan Voosholz’s newly published work Towards a New Scientific Realism. The book develops a new type of scientific realism beyond naturalism, correlationism, and what the author calls “objective realism.” Jan Voosholz combines a critical engagement with current debates on realism and antirealism in the philosophy of science with contributions from speculative and new realist ontology and epistemology. From this emerges an independent perspective on a pluralistic natural philosophy. The event offers an opportunity for discussion with the author as well as with distinguished experts in the field.
